Family waited four months to have phone connected

A Bognor Regis family have finally been connected by phone after a delay of almost four months.

Jennifer Whichello, her husband and children aged four and one at last had their landline phone switched on last Friday.

They placed an order around August 16 for the telephone line to start on August 25 when they moved into their Hook Lane home from Middleton.

They thought transferring the existing landline from the previous owner to their name would be easy.

But it turned into a long-running saga and a catalague of confusion and mishaps. She has never been given an explanation for the problems.

Mrs Whichello (38) had to make numerous phone calls to BT '“ either on a mobile or using the nearest telephone box a seven minute walk away '“ to try to resolve the situation. The longest of these calls lasted an hour and 42 minutes.

At one stage, a BT engineer who made it to her home had to hang up after waiting for 45 minutes for an answer to his query about the situation.

Amid the confusion and delays, Mrs Whichello had to cope with her father-in-law's death without being able to use a landline to make a stressful situation worse. She was his registered career and the family moved into the property together in August.

But he passed away at the age of 76 on the night of November 16.

Mrs Whichello said: "I came downstairs to find him collapsed on the kitchen floor.

"I dashed to my mobile to call an ambulance and managed to state my name.

"The signal failed. Extremely distressed, a managed to find my father-in-law's telephone and duly, on a different network, managed to re-establish connection.

"The ambulance arrived but it was too late because my father-in-law had passed away.

"I am utterly exhausted and furious at BT, during a very stressful and upsetting time of my life.

"Despite having explained on the telephone to BT staff, that a landline is essential to my daily life, it seemed that the company did not care.

"Nobody has been in touch about the phone working.

"I just picked it up and it was all right. The whole situation has been disgraceful. The way we have been treated is not right."

BT was not available to comment.
